A rectangular floor is fully covered with square tiles of identical size. The tiles on the edges are white and the tiles in the interior are red. The number of white tiles is the same as the number of red tiles. A possible value of the number of tiles along one edge of the floor is

Two circles, both of radii intersect such that the circumference of each one passes through the centre of the other. What is the area (in sq. .) of the intersecting region?
